Skyone
Português
Português
  • Home
  • Plataforma Skyone
    • Visão Geral
    • Acesso e Cadastro
      • Recuperar senha da plataforma
    • Configurações e Preferências
      • Meu Perfil
      • Gestão de Usuários
        • Como convidar um usuário para a plataforma?
        • Opções para Gestão de Usuários
        • Tipos de permissões de usuários
      • Convites
      • Minha Empresa
      • Configuração de Casos de Suporte
      • Gestão de Empresas
      • Faturamento
      • Configurações
      • Segurança
      • Feedback
      • Logs
      • Cancelamento
      • Parceiro-Clientes
        • Meus Clientes
        • Meu Parceiro
    • Notificação
    • Health: Verificação do status da plataforma
    • Casos de suporte
      • Como acompanhar e responder os casos de suporte?
      • Guia para abertura de chamados ABO
  • Computação em Nuvem
    • Visão Geral
    • Autosky
      • Login e Registro de senha
        • Recuperação de Senha
      • Perfil e preferências
      • Recursos do Autosky
        • Dashboard
        • Contas
          • Servidores
            • Opções dos servidores
        • Ambientes
          • Ambiente Micro
            • Instâncias do ambiente micro
            • Servidores do ambiente micro
          • Ambiente Scaling
            • Instâncias do ambiente scaling
            • Servidores do ambiente scaling
          • Outros recursos dos ambientes
        • Clientes
          • Editar e Clonar
          • Usuários
          • Aplicações
          • Sessões
          • Gerenciar Restrições de Acesso
          • Manutenção
            • Histórico de manutenção:
        • Usuários
    • Servidores em Nuvem
      • Opções de Servidores em Nuvem
      • Auditoria de Backups
  • Studio
    • Visão Geral
      • Criação da conta
      • Recuperar senha
      • Guia rápido da plataforma
      • Como testar a plataforma gratuitamente
      • Espaço de trabalho
        • Criação de novo espaço
        • Encontrar um espaço
        • Enviar convite para um espaço
        • Editar um espaço
      • Organizações
        • Criando uma Organização
        • Visão Geral da Organização
        • Administração da Organização
        • Monitoramento da Organização
      • Configurações e Preferências
        • Perfil
        • Notificações
        • Uso e Pagamento
        • Usuários e permissões
    • Integrações
      • Gestão das integrações
        • Criar integração
        • Importar integração
        • Editar integração
        • Opções da integração
        • Fluxos dessa integração
      • Fluxos
        • Gestão dos fluxos
          • Criar fluxo
          • Opções do fluxo
          • Flow Canva: configuração e edição do fluxo
            • Flow Canva: visão geral
            • Exception Handler
              • Configuração do Exception Handler
              • Cases do Exception Handler
            • Fluxos Multicontexto
              • Exemplo: Multicontexto com API Gateway
              • Exemplo: Multicontexto com Gatilho Temporal
            • Configuração do fluxo
        • Gatilhos
          • Gatilhos API Gateway: Adição e Configuração
          • Gatilhos AS2: Adição e Configuração
          • Gatilho de Fila: Adição e Configuração
          • Gatilhos de Fluxo: Adição e Configuração
          • Gatilhos Temporais: Adição e Configuração
          • Gatilhos Webhook: Adição e Configuração
        • Módulos Ferramentais
          • Módulo AS2
          • Módulo CSV
          • Módulo Chamada de Fluxo
          • Módulo Data Balancer
          • Módulo Data SQL execute
          • Módulo EDI
          • Módulo File Job Execute
          • Módulo IF
          • Módulo JavaScript
          • Módulo JSONata Job Execute
          • Módulo Log
          • Módulo Loop Do While
          • Módulo Loop For
          • Módulo Retorno
          • Módulo Transformação de Dados
          • Módulo XML
          • Outros Módulos Ferramentais da plataforma
      • Cabeçalho dos módulos
      • Conectando componentes de um fluxo
      • Edição de gatilhos e módulos no fluxo
      • Operações de Dados
        • Manipulação de Objetos
          • Exemplo prático: Manipulação de variáveis
        • SMOP (Pequenas Operações)
        • Regras de Parametrização
    • Módulos
      • Gestão de módulos
        • Criação de Módulos
        • Importar Módulos
          • Arquivos IAC - Integration as Code
        • Edição de Módulos
        • Opções de Módulos
      • Configurações & Operações
        • Configurações de Módulos
          • Conectividade: Banco de Dados
          • Conectividade: Email
          • Conectividade: REST
          • Conectividade: SOAP
          • Conectividade: Arquivo
          • Conectividade: RFC
          • Gestão das contas conectadas
        • Operações de Módulos
          • Importar operações em módulos REST
          • Gestão das operações
        • Fluxos usando este Módulo
    • Monitoramento
    • API Gateway
    • Terminais & Agente
      • Agente
        • Versões suportadas pelo Agente
        • Como atualizar a versão do Agente
        • Como fazer backup dos arquivos do Agente
      • Terminais
    • Data Management
      • Engine
        • Como utilizar o Proxy para Data Engine
      • Parâmetros
      • Filtros de arquivo
      • Templates de arquivo
      • File Jobs
      • JSONata Jobs
    • Data Lake
    • Data Warehouse
      • Data Jobs
      • Banco de Dados
    • Inteligência Artificial
    • How to
      • Inserir JSON em bancos de dados
      • Flattening: Transformação de dados utilizando JSONata
      • Como utilizar o Form Data
      • Entendendo a recursividade no JSONata
      • Consolidação de output de módulo REST
      • Como configurar um timeout de um componente?
      • Isolar na execução: conceito e aplicação em variáveis
      • Parâmetros de URL no API Gateway
      • Caso de uso: parâmetros de gatilho API Gateway
      • Caso de uso: Exception Handler em transações financeiras
      • Caso de uso: utilizando Grupos para gerenciar acessos aos fluxos
      • Como criar endpoint para download e integrar com o Power BI
      • É possível usar dois gatilhos em um único fluxo?
    • FAQ
    • GIGS: O guia completo
    • Glossário
  • Cibersegurança
    • Visão Geral
    • Análise de Ameaças
      • Painel de Segurança
      • Alvos
      • Agendamentos
      • Resolução de Alvos
      • Grupo de Ameaças
      • Relatório
    • Como instalar os agentes de segurança do Bitdefender
Powered by GitBook
On this page
  • Conceito
  • Contas Conectadas
  • Gerenciamento dos Terminais
  1. Studio
  2. Terminais & Agente

Terminais

PreviousComo fazer backup dos arquivos do AgenteNextData Management

Last updated 2 days ago

Conceito

Um terminal é uma entidade lógica que representa a conexão de um único "Agente", instalado em uma máquina e vinculado a um usuário, ao "Espaço de Trabalho" desse usuário na plataforma.

Um "Espaço de Trabalho" pode conter vários terminais. Além disso, qualquer usuário do espaço pode executar o Agente.

Em uma máquina com um "Agente" instalado, um terminal atua como um intermediário para permitir que uma aplicação acesse o Banco de Dados de uma empresa ou a interface REST de um ERP. Isso possibilita várias integrações diferentes sem a necessidade de uma API pública. Assim, diversos fluxos dentro de um "Espaço de Trabalho" podem usar o mesmo terminal, conectados por uma ou mais contas de usuário.

Após instalar e configurar um "Agente" em um ambiente local (On Premises), automaticamente é criado um terminal na plataforma Skyone Studio. Daí em diante, você pode escolher e usar esse terminal na plataforma para configurar contas do tipo REST ou Banco de Dados. Quando você seleciona um terminal na configuração dessas contas, as credenciais da conta são enviadas ao Agente para serem usadas localmente.

Você pode associar várias contas conectadas a um único terminal. Isso significa que você pode criar diversos usuários em um banco de dados para serem utilizados em diferentes integrações. Cada usuário poderá ser configurado em uma conta distinta, mas todas as contas apontarão para o mesmo terminal.

O terminal de um "Agente" é permanentemente monitorado, de forma que a plataforma sempre sabe quando ele está conectado e operacional. Por outro lado, a queda de um terminal, percebida através da desconexão do "Agente" a ele conectado, implica a queda de todas as contas conectadas a ele associadas.

É possível instalar quantos "Agentes" você quiser, para um mesmo usuário ou "Espaço de Trabalho", desde que sejam instalados em diferentes dispositivos e com nomes e localização distintos. Cada um deles aparecerá como um diferente terminal na plataforma.

Contas Conectadas

Por padrão, o campo "Terminal" de uma conta do tipo REST ou Banco de Dados é deixado em branco, o que corresponde à não utilização do "Agente" durante a conexão. Para utilizar um "Agente" previamente instalado, você deverá selecionar um dentre os terminais (ativos ou não) que estão configurados no sistema:

Quando você utiliza um "Terminal" numa conta, a execução de operações em um módulo (testes) ou em um fluxo (testes ou execução) somente ocorrerá se o "Agente" estiver sendo executado e o status do "Terminal" estiver ativo (verde).

Gerenciamento dos Terminais

Na aba "Terminais" você verá todos os terminais conectados ao "Espaço de Trabalho" selecionado. Caso não tenha ainda instalado e configurado um agente, poderá baixar o "Agente" clicando em "Baixar Agente".

Após a configuração de um ou mais Agentes, a lista dos terminais disponíveis e seus respectivos detalhes e status serão exibidos na tela:

Cada linha corresponde a uma entrada de "Agente" com as suas informações básicas. As informações desta tela são dinâmicas, com atualização automática em alguns segundos.

Sendo que:

  • ID: identificador único do "Agente"

  • Nome do Agente: nome atribuído na configuração do "Agente"

  • Conectado em: última vez que o "Agente" se conectou

  • IP do Agente: endereço IP do computador onde o "Agente" foi instalado, exibido apenas quando este está conectado

  • Host ID: assinatura do host que identifica unicamente a máquina onde o "Agente" está instalado

  • Status: status da conexão do "Agente"

Informações do Terminal

Para visualizar informações detalhadas de um terminal:

  1. Em "Terminais", escolha o "Agente" que deseja visualizar e clique no ícone de "Mais Opções";

  2. Selecione "Visualizar";

  1. A tela visualização das Informações do Terminal será exibida e você verá os seguintes campos:

  • Host ID: assinatura do host, que identifica de forma única a máquina onde o "Agente" está instalado

  • Nome do Agente: nome fornecido na configuração do "Agente"

  • Localização do Agente: localização fornecida na configuração do "Agente"

  • IP do Agente: endereço IP da máquina onde o "Agente" está instalado

  • Conectado em: data da última conexão, no formato DD/MM/AAAA HH:MM:SS

  • Último controle do APC: última vez que a plataforma enviou uma APC (Agent Procedure Call - chamada realizada pelo "Agente" )

  • Último dado do APC: última vez que a plataforma recebeu mensagens

  • Controles entregues pelo APC: quantidade de mensagens enviadas

  • Dados recebidos pelo APC: quantidade de mensagens recebidas

  • Contas Conectadas: contas que apontam para o "Terminal"

Testar a Conexão

O status da conexão garante que existe uma conexão estabelecida, porém não garante o funcionamento completo. O teste de conexão executa um teste completo envolvendo o "Agente" .

Para testar a conexão:

  1. Em "Terminais", escolha o "Agente" cuja conexão deseja testar e clique em "Mais Opções" (ícone de três pontos);

  2. Selecione "Testar Conexão";

  1. Aguarde a conexão ser testada e o resultado.

Logs do Terminal

Para ver os logs de um terminal:

  1. Em "Terminais", escolha o "Agente" que deseja ver os logs e clique no ícone de "Mais Opções";

  2. Selecione "Logs";

  1. Os logs do terminal será exibido (se houver).

Excluir um Agente

Caso você exclua um "Agente" da aba "Terminais" e queira depois voltar a utilizar a aplicação, será necessário desinstalar e reinstalar a aplicação. Isto também é necessário caso deseje alterar as configurações iniciais de instalação (Espaço de Trabalho, conta do Skyone Studio, Nome e Localização do Agente).

Para excluir um "Agente", siga os seguintes passos:

  1. Em "Terminais", escolha o Agente que deseja excluir e clique no ícone de "Mais Opções";

  2. Selecione "Excluir";

  1. Digite o nome do terminal que deseja excluir e, em seguida, confirme a ação clicando em "Excluir";

  1. De volta ao "Agente" , a conexão ao servidor será interrompida. Para configurar novamente o "Agente" será necessária a desinstalação e reinstalação.

Conceito
Contas Conectadas
Gerenciamento dos Terminais
Informações do Terminal
Testar a Conexão
Logs do Terminal
Excluir um Agente
Exemplo de configuração de conta conectada